How the Research Office helps with your application

  1. The Research Office sets internal closing dates, usually about 10 days before the granting body deadline, to allow sufficient time for the checking of applications.

  2. Research Office staff are available to assist you with interpretation of complex guidelines. We review your submissions and offer constructive comments and suggestions to increase their clarity and effectiveness.

  3. We check your application for compliance with granting body guidelines e.g. eligibility, required elements, attachments, number of copies.

  4. We offer suggestions, in relation to the text where relevant - and when time permits - in order to better align the application to the granting body’s preferred submission style, or to avoid the application being rejected because required information has not been provided.

  5. We check that the budget has been prepared according to granting body requirements e.g. overhead costs included, exclusive of GST. We do not undertake detailed budget checking such as whether correct salary scales have been used or whether totals are correct; these are matters more appropriately handled at the Departmental level in conjunction with the Resources Managers.

  6. If required, we advise you by phone or email of suggested changes to the application and how soon the revisions are required.

  7. We despatch the application with a covering letter to the grantor stating that the University endorses the submission of the application. In addition we will attach the ATO letters endorsing the university as a tax deductible gift recipient and as an income tax exempt charitable entity, and any Annual Report if required.

  8. Details of applications are recorded on the university’s grants database and the information is used to provide feedback to faculties.

Running late with your application?

Because of the number of processing steps involved, we need prior warning of late applications. Applicants who anticipate having difficulty in meeting the Branch deadlines should contact the Monash Research Office to arrange an appropriate extension of time and inform their Associate Dean (Research) of this arrangement.

Role of the Department for Major Schemes

Beside the HOD's endorsement of the application on the Monash Research Office Cover Sheet and/or the application itself, it is expected that for major schemes a more detailed examination of the text of the application would be undertaken within the Department, School or Centre. In such cases the signatures of the reviewer/mentor/reader and all named participants are required on the appropriate cover sheet. 

The HOD is aware of the Department's emerging and existing research strengths and where the Faculty/Department/School wishes to position itself and should review applications to major schemes.
